Mangaluru: Malayalam actor Jayakrishnan and two associates, Santosh Abraham and Vimal, have been named in an FIR for allegedly verbally abusing a cab driver with communal remarks in Mangaluru, police said on Saturday.
No arrests have been made so far. The incident reportedly took place on the night of October 9 when the trio booked a cab via a mobile app from Bejai New Road.
The cab driver, Ahmed Shafiq (32), alleged that he was subjected to verbal abuse in Hindi and Malayalam when he contacted them to confirm the pickup location, according to the complaint filed at Urwa Police Station on Friday.
The FIR has been registered under Sections 352 and 353(2) of the Bharatiya Nyaya Sanhita.
"Digital trails identified them; statements are being recorded," a police source said.
